Transaction 845942ce72ea081877b2124218440032d6b638ecd354813b321e3bfdb43411d4
2 Input
2 Outputs
- 845942ce72ea081877b2124218440032d6b638ecd354813b321e3bfdb43411d4:0
- 845942ce72ea081877b2124218440032d6b638ecd354813b321e3bfdb43411d4:1
value 3363
address 1C4HzzWf1hJhihPfR41TEzutSSc21JsmaJ
value 521107
address 1QGRS9kSLAGo2iEUsqvKpHggUFLc3JEFAC